The Beginnings of Cher’s Career (1963)

Cher’s real name is Cherilyn Sarkisian. Cher’s journey to fame commenced early in her life. In 1962, at the age of 16, she made the bold decision to drop out of high school and pursue a career in entertainment in Los Angeles. Fate intervened when she crossed paths with Sonny Bono, and together, they formed the iconic musical duo, Sonny & Cher. However, before achieving breakthrough success, Cher performed under various stage names.

In 1964, Cher’s star ascended with the release of her single, “All I Really Want to Do.” This marked the beginning of a decade of chart-topping hits with Sonny, including classics such as “I Got You Babe,” “The Beat Goes On,” “Baby Don’t Go,” and more. Despite the duo’s success, Cher also embarked on a solo career, releasing records and albums that achieved significant acclaim.

Not confined to the music scene, Cher made her foray into television with the variety show “Sonny and Cher Comedy Hour,” where she starred alongside her then-husband. Following their separation and the show’s conclusion, Cher expanded her acting career, securing prominent roles in major Hollywood productions.

Singing and acting became the cornerstones of Cher’s career, a path she diligently pursued for an astonishing 60 years, earning her a few million dollars annually.

Cher’s Current Net Worth: $360 Million

Despite her relatively modest annual income, Cher’s astute financial planning and diverse revenue streams have propelled her net worth to an impressive $360 million. This accomplishment places her among the wealthiest female celebrities in Hollywood. What makes this feat even more remarkable is the fact that Cher’s average income per year, at just $6 million, might appear substantial to the average person but is notably modest for someone of her stature and career longevity.

Cher’s wealth primarily derives from the royalties she continues to receive for her iconic records, which continue to generate substantial earnings. Additionally, her lucrative Las Vegas residency, coupled with consistently strong ticket sales from her worldwide tours, has significantly contributed to her financial success. Cher’s extensive touring history spans multiple decades, a practice she still maintains today.

Cher’s influence extends beyond the music industry; she has made a significant impact on the world of film and entertainment. Her filmography includes box office hits like “Moonstruck,” “Mermaids,” and “Mamma Mia! Here We Go Again.” Furthermore, she ventured into the fragrance market with products like “Uninhibited” in 1987 and “Cher Eau de Couture” in 2019. As she matured, Cher harnessed her marketability by appearing in infomercials and commercials.

However, a recent setback has affected Cher’s accrued net worth. The widow of her former husband and partner, Sonny Bono, terminated the estate’s contract with Cher, thereby cutting off her revenue from royalties for Sonny & Cher songs. Cher’s entitlement to 50 percent of the royalties for songwriting and recording was jeopardized. In response, Cher initiated a lawsuit to address this breach of contract, and fortunately, the case was not dismissed by a federal judge. This legal battle offers Cher the opportunity to reclaim royalties amounting to up to $1 million from the Bono estate.

Cher’s Ongoing Pursuits and Future Prospects

Cher’s Earnings and Upcoming Ventures

Cher’s financial journey remains far from over. The entertainer continues to tour the country, with rumors circulating about her return to her Las Vegas residency, which was curtailed due to the COVID-19 pandemic in 2020. Her previous residency, spanning three years, netted her a staggering $60 million. It is entirely plausible that her return could be even more financially rewarding.

In addition to her touring endeavors, Cher has listed her Miami residence for sale at a substantial $72 million in 2022. This strategic move could further bolster her already considerable wealth.

Not one to rest on her laurels, the multi-talented singer is back in the studio, actively working on a new album. Even beyond her music and real estate ventures, Cher remains passionately engaged in various forms of activism. Notably, she is committed to advocating for the liberation of an elephant named Billy from the confines of the L.A. Zoo.
